11/3/2014 - Emergency Shelter Information
Bangor city officials, along with Police, Fire, Penobscot County AMA, Red Cross, Public Works and Parks and Recreation met this afternoon in regards to those Bangor residents who are still without power and/or heat.

Emera Maine has made significant progress in Bangor today and their efforts are continuing. Emera Maine is asking customers to assist in the restoration by ensuring driveways and rights of ways are plowed and sanded to allow them to access the areas and work safely as they restore service. And, as always, NEVER go near a downed line or a tree in contact with a line

The Bangor Parks and Recreation’s temporary day shelter will close at 6PM this evening and open tomorrow at 7AM.

If you find yourself in need and have no other option or shelter after 7PM this evening please stop into the Bangor Police Department for coffee, warmth and use the phone. If you cannot get to the station call 947-7382 and ask to speak with the Commanding Officer.

If you do not live in Bangor 211 is the number to call for information regarding warming shelters near you.

Please check on your elderly friends and relatives and those who live alone and make sure they’re all okay.

Bangor Fire Department would like to remind all without power to use candles minimally and safely. Flashlights and other alternative lighting work best! If you’re using a generator please keep it outdoors, and only use approved alternative heating sources.
